Azerbaijan, Baku, Nov. 1 / Trend H. Valiyev /
The Azerbaijani Communications and IT Ministry has prepared new rules for rendering electronic services, the Ministry told Trend on Thursday.
According to the ministry, one of the important aspects of the new rules to be adopted by late 2012 is the development of e-services at a regional level.
The rules reflect the use of online registration of the national domain .az, which is being currently discussed and the number one problem.
"The issue of online registration of the domain .az must be considered through a different prism," a source said. "There are a number of important issues that must be resolved. There are problems with personal identification or the moral norms which must be observed. Some countries, for example, have a list of domain addresses. Their registration is unacceptable. These are internet addresses containing profanity. Unfortunately, we do not have this yet."
A national domain cannot be issued to foreigners or offices of foreign companies in Azerbaijan. This is an objective reason that the online registration system is not available.
According to INTRANS, regarding the technical side, the domain online registration system is ready. The company predicts that it will be available to the public in the near future.
